    SoO Protection Trinkets.

    Sorry if this has been discussed but i failed to find anything. My guilds only 5 bosses in right now hopfully 6-8 by the end of the week. Really casual guild only raiding 5 hours a week. But anyway, i was going over the SoO loot and found some unusual trinkets. And now I'm kind of lost on what trinkets i should be Aiming to get, I'm the MOAR HASTE kind of pally.

    What would you guys rank the trinkets for protection pallies in SoO?

    As far as I know, the current BiS trinkets are Thok's Tail Tip & the trinket from immerseus(the amp is far too strong, around 2800 haste if you use both trinkets), if you like me think its a waste of main stats using a int proc trinket, use the Vial of Living Corruption.

    Most trinkets in SoO are purely situational tho, keep that in mind.

    AMP trinkets start to get strong only at high (550+?) gear level.
    At my lowly 535 I have around 22k ratings total, so 7% amp gives a total of 1550 stats. Which is lower than ToT trinkets.
    And, with our crit ratings, what, +1% healing?

    SoO trinkets are a complete wash for prot paladins. The tier is not difficult or tight enough to demand such specialised trinkets. And because there isn't a second 'pure-BiS' alternative, chances are people with either use that intellect trinket or stick with t15 BiS.

    Big problem with giving situational trinkets is they aren't mandatory, else your progress would be determined by RNG on loot. The worst are fights like Malkorok HM where the one fight that would have truly have benefitted from the CD reduction trinket...drops from that encounter. Completely counter intuitive to the design intent.

    Think of it like this, after the first 9 bosses in HM SoO, I can say with absolute conviction that these utility trinkets (healing conversion, CD reduction, cleave, AoE reduction etc) attempt to solve a problem that doesn't exist.

    It is possible the last 5 bosses will change my opinion, but simply put once the average player gets to HMs with 565 ilevel you won't be worried even consider utility that comes at the cost of so much haste/DPS output.

    As for the int one, I feel the useless proc isn't enough to put it ahead of the Spark in terms of usefulness. I haven't bothered to delve much into end tier BiS loot.

    Min-maxing such as what they attempted with trinkets must be left to talents/glyphs, ones where everything is actually avaliable for a given situation. Or else people will simply make do without them.
